Science is a system of acquiring knowledge and relies on observation, experimentation, and interpretation to describe natural phenomena. Scientific knowledge is built through hypothesis testing, and theories arise that explain why and how the natural world operates. Paleontology is the study of ancient life and is a multi-disciplinary science that requires knowledge of not just biology, but also geology, physics, chemistry, and many others. The field of dinosaur paleontology has a colored history and experienced a renaissance in the 1970s that led to a renewed view of these amazing prehistoric creatures. The study of dinosaur paleontology and Earth’s past is critical in shaping how we view, predict, and plan for Earth’s future.
